About the Role
We are looking for a highly detail-oriented and proactive Plant Accounts Executive to manage financial operations at the plant level. This role is critical in ensuring accurate accounting, strong control over inventory, and smooth financial coordination between plant operations and the central finance team. You will play a key role in maintaining financial discipline, improving processes, and supporting business decision-making through accurate data and reporting.
Key Responsibilities
• Manage end-to-end plant accounting activities, ensuring accuracy and compliance.
• Handle inventory accounting, including stock tracking, valuation, and reconciliation with physical inventory.
• Drive vendor reconciliation and ensure timely closure of discrepancies.
• Manage invoice generation, validation, and tracking for plant transactions.
• Maintain accurate books of accounts using Tally ERP.
• Support monthly closing, MIS reporting, and audit requirements.
• Monitor and control plant-level expenses and cost tracking.
• Collaborate with operations, procurement, and finance teams for smooth financial workflows.
• Identify gaps and drive process improvements and controls in plant accounting.
• Ensure adherence to company policies and statutory compliance.

The Company
What We Do
DriveX Mobility is an Indian auto-tech platform focused on certified second-hand two-wheelers. It enables customers to buy, sell, service, and finance used bikes online, with each vehicle subjected to more than 300 quality checks. The company aims to make refurbished motorcycles and scooters more reliable and accessible by combining vehicle inspection, retail, servicing, and financing in an integrated marketplace for Indian riders.
